These moves reflect a period of major successes and expansion for Havas Worldwide, one of the world's largest marketing communications agencies.
Recent months at Euro RSCG Worldwide have seen major new business wins with international brands such as Heineken, AkzoNobel's Dulux, Credit Suisse and Pernod Ricard's Jacob's Creek, plus major digital wins including IBM's global digital business, EDF, Heineken and Lacoste, and being named to the Unilever global digital roster. In 2009, Euro was named digital agency of record and/or social media agency of record for such clients as Barilla, Clearasil, GSK, Ikea, method, P&G, sanofi-aventis, Shire Pharmaceuticals and Sprint.
Ryan joined Euro RSCG from Havas sister company Arnold Worldwide, where he was executive director running the global Volvo relationship. Prior to joining Arnold, Ryan was consulting to Gillette, P&G, Wyeth, Novartis, Ford, Shell, Absolut Vodka, Mitsubishi and other leading global marketers on agency model configuration, agency selection and compensation as a principle of Roth Associates.
During Ryan's tenure as global CMO of Euro RSCG Worldwide, he led global new business efforts, helped develop best practices for the network's business development organization and assisted in growing global brands.
Troni, who spent two years as Euro's global new business director, will now be responsible for managing the network's global new business and marketing practices. In this role, she will leverage regional new business successes and promote marketing best practices across all 233 Euro RSCG Worldwide offices.
Before working as global new business director of Euro RSCG Worldwide, Troni led new business and client development for Euro RSCG's London agency, as well as business development and integration across the Euro RSCG U.K. group. During her tenure, the U.K. agency won more than $200 million in new billings from brands such as News International, Staples, Superdrug and LG Electronics. Troni also ran the relationship with News International.
This year, Euro RSCG Worldwide has also been named Adweek's first-ever Healthcare Agency Of The Year, runner-up for Global Agency Of The Year from Campaign, No. 2 on the Ad Age Agency A-List and European Communication Group of the Year by Les Agences de l'Annee. And for the twelfth time in 16 years, BETC Euro RSCG was named Creative Agency Of The Year by CB News Hits d'Or.
